Erasing Registered Information

You can erase information (face info, names, and birthdays) registered to
Face ID. However, names recorded in previously shot images will not be
erased.

If you erase a registered person's info, you will not be able to
display their name ( = 115), overwrite their info ( = 119), or
search for images that include them ( = 116).
You can also erase names in image information ( = 119).
